编程python之前学什么
-
在学习编程Python之前,你可以考虑先学习一些基础知识和概念,这样能够更好地理解和应用Python编程语言。下面是一些你可以考虑学习的内容:
-
计算机基础知识:了解计算机的工作原理、操作系统、数据结构和算法等基本概念。这样可以帮助你更好地理解编程的内部机制。
-
编程基础知识:学习编程的基本概念,如变量、数据类型、运算符、控制流程(条件语句、循环语句)、函数等。这些是编程的基础,也是Python语言所共有的核心概念。
-
掌握一门编程语言:你可以选择学习其他编程语言,如C、C++或Java,这些语言在工业界广泛应用,并且可以帮助你更深入地理解编程概念和逻辑。
-
理解面向对象编程(OOP):Python是一种面向对象的编程语言,掌握面向对象编程的概念对于学习和使用Python非常重要。你可以学习类、对象、继承、封装、多态等概念。
-
学习数据结构和算法:数据结构和算法是编程的基石,对于解决实际问题和优化代码非常重要。了解常见的数据结构(如数组、链表、栈、队列、树、图等)和算法(如排序、查找、递归等)可以帮助你在编程中更高效地处理数据和解决问题。
-
实践编程练习:在学习理论知识的同时,也要进行实际的编程练习。这样可以巩固所学知识,提高编程能力。你可以尝试解决一些简单的问题,参与编程挑战,或者参与开源项目。
总之,在学习编程Python之前,建议你掌握计算机基础知识、编程基础知识、面向对象编程、数据结构和算法,并进行实践练习。这样将为你学习和应用Python编程语言打下坚实的基础。
1年前 -
-
在学习编程Python之前,你可以先学习以下几个基本的概念和技能:
-
计算机基础知识:了解计算机的工作原理、操作系统、网络等基本的计算机概念和原理,对于理解编程语言的工作方式和目的非常重要。
-
算法和数据结构:学习算法和数据结构的基本原理和概念,包括数组、链表、栈、队列、树等常用数据结构和排序、查找等常用算法。这将帮助你更好地理解和实现程序的逻辑和功能。
-
编程基础知识:学习基本的编程概念和语法,包括变量、数据类型、控制结构(如条件语句和循环语句)、函数等。此外,了解一些常用的编程工具和环境(例如命令行、集成开发环境等)也是很有帮助的。
-
数学基础知识:学习基础的数学概念和运算,例如代数、几何、概率与统计等。这对于编写涉及到数学计算和问题求解的程序非常重要。
-
解决问题的思维能力:学习如何分析和解决问题的能力是编程的重要一环。这包括强化逻辑思维能力、学习如何将问题拆解成更小的子问题、学习如何使用适当的算法和数据结构等。
总而言之,学习编程Python之前,你需要掌握计算机基础知识、算法和数据结构、编程基础知识、数学基础知识以及解决问题的思维能力。通过掌握这些基本概念和技能,你将更好地理解和应用Python编程语言。
1年前 -
-
在学习编程Python之前,你可以先学习一些基础知识和概念,这将有助于你更好地理解和掌握Python编程。以下是一些建议的学习内容:
-
计算机基础知识:了解计算机的组成、工作原理以及基本术语如数据类型、算法等。
-
基本的编程概念:掌握一些编程的基本概念,如变量、数据类型、条件语句、循环语句、函数等。
-
数学和逻辑思维:数学和逻辑思维是编程的基石,因此学习一些基本的数学概念和逻辑思维方法可以帮助你更好地理解和解决问题。
-
算法和数据结构:学习一些常用的算法和数据结构,如数组、链表、栈、队列、排序算法等,这将帮助你优化程序的效率。
-
命令行和操作系统:学会使用命令行工具,了解常用的操作系统命令,如文件操作、进程管理等,这对于编程的调试和开发非常有帮助。
-
熟悉开发工具:选择一个适合你的集成开发环境(IDE)或文本编辑器,学会使用其基本功能,如代码编写、调试等。
-
学习其他编程语言:学习其他编程语言,如C、Java等,可以帮助你扩展编程思维和理解Python编程的特点。
通过以上的准备工作,你将为学习Python编程打下坚实的基础。这些知识和技能对于理解和编写Python代码非常有帮助,并有助于你进一步探索和学习其他编程领域。
1年前 -